Mother Dear....a solider's letter home

Mother dear what do you cry for
I'm old enough to go to war.
I'm still your child, yet now a man.
I'll serve my country best I can.

Oh mother, please, they say you weep
When safe at home, my brothers sleep.
It really isn't all that bad.
Please give my best to dear old dad.

Mother, you remember Jim.
It's been three days since I've seen him.
They say he stepped on enemy mine.
He lost his leg, but he'll be fine.

Now Pete, my friend from down the street,
Who always stumbled on his feet
Spooked a patrol out on the roam
So in a body bag, he's coming home.

Today we stormed their sea and land;
Which gave our troops the upper hand.
Forgive the blood, it's just a nick.
I'll be like new, I'm sure, real quick.

We won today. The feeling's great.
I have to go though, it's getting late.
So mother dear, this is goodbye...

P.S. They say that I might die

~ Ruth
